Lines Matching refs:terminator

2189 PCRE2_UCHAR terminator;  /* Don't combine these lines; the Solaris cc */  in check_posix_syntax()  local
2190 terminator = *ptr++; /* compiler warns about "non-constant" initializer. */ in check_posix_syntax()
2198 else if ((*ptr == CHAR_LEFT_SQUARE_BRACKET && ptr[1] == terminator) || in check_posix_syntax()
2201 else if (*ptr == terminator && ptr[1] == CHAR_RIGHT_SQUARE_BRACKET) in check_posix_syntax()
2273 read_name(PCRE2_SPTR *ptrptr, PCRE2_SPTR ptrend, BOOL utf, uint32_t terminator, in read_name() argument
2359 if (ptr >= ptrend || *ptr != (PCRE2_UCHAR)terminator) in read_name()
2586 uint32_t terminator; in parse_regex() local
3077 terminator = (*ptr == CHAR_LESS_THAN_SIGN)? in parse_regex()
3083 if (escape == ESC_g && terminator != CHAR_RIGHT_CURLY_BRACKET) in parse_regex()
3090 if (p >= ptrend || *p != terminator) in parse_regex()
3103 if (!read_name(&ptr, ptrend, utf, terminator, &offset, &name, &namelen, in parse_regex()
3110 (escape == ESC_k || terminator == CHAR_RIGHT_CURLY_BRACKET)? in parse_regex()
4045 terminator = CHAR_GREATER_THAN_SIGN; in parse_regex()
4357 terminator = CHAR_RIGHT_PARENTHESIS; in parse_regex()
4362 terminator = CHAR_GREATER_THAN_SIGN; in parse_regex()
4364 terminator = CHAR_APOSTROPHE; in parse_regex()
4367 terminator = CHAR_RIGHT_PARENTHESIS; in parse_regex()
4370 if (!read_name(&ptr, ptrend, utf, terminator, &offset, &name, &namelen, in parse_regex()
4385 else if (terminator == CHAR_RIGHT_PARENTHESIS) in parse_regex()
4463 terminator = CHAR_GREATER_THAN_SIGN; in parse_regex()
4510 terminator = CHAR_APOSTROPHE; /* Terminator */ in parse_regex()
4513 if (!read_name(&ptr, ptrend, utf, terminator, &offset, &name, &namelen, in parse_regex()